My client is a leading beauty brand seeking a results-oriented and commercially astute National Account Manager to oversee key retail partnerships and accelerate growth. The role involves managing relationships across prominent UK and European retail channels, driving strategic planning, and executing commercial initiatives to support brand performance.

  • Account Management: Oversee major retail accounts, fostering strong buyer relationships and securing new business across UK and international markets. Lead negotiations on pricing, promotions, and commercial terms.
  • Sales & Analysis: Own account-level P&L, track performance, analyse sales trends, and provide actionable insights. Deliver accurate sales forecasts, align inventory with demand, and work closely with distribution partners to support fulfilment.
  • Commercial Strategy: Drive margin optimisation, manage trade spend and investments, and negotiate placements, marketing, and third-party services.
  • Retail & Brand Execution: Partner with trade marketing to ensure strong in-store and online execution. Present new product launches and identify growth and efficiency opportunities.

At least 2 years managing a key health and beauty retail account (especially Boots and Superdrug). Ideally experienced with major UK retailers and strong exposure to online/e-commerce platforms. Experience working with grocery and European retail markets is desirable. Strong relationship management and analytical skills. Proficient in Excel and PowerPoint to support insights and presentations.
